The 5th ed Imperial Guard Codex doesn't appear to mention anywhere that company/platoon commanders are independent characters so I just assumed they weren't.

BUT... the official rules FAQ says they are independent characters!?

I'm slightly confused here...

I thought at first the FAQ was outdated as the 4th Ed Codex said they were independent characters though I've only just realised the FAQ is from Feb this year, well after 5th Ed codex came out!

There is nothing in IG FAQ. So whats the deal here? Can they be targetted in CC like Independent Characters and are they worth a seperate kill point, or is the FAQ just badly updated?

Ah, bit of a problem... the codex was released May {?} 2009 and the FAQ is dated Feb 2010.

The FAQ seems to be referring to the last chapter ‘Retinues’.

“Some Codex books allow you to field characters together with a special unit they cannot leave during the game (which is usually called a ‘retinue’, ‘bodyguard’ or similar)Where this is the case, the character counts as an upgraded character until the other members of the unit are killed, at which point it starts counting as an independent character and it will do so for the rest of the game”


So, RAW, your platoon or HQ commanders are upgraded characters unless the rest of the group are wiped out, then they become ICs. The FAQ clarifies that if the entire group is destroyed, together or separately, they are individual kill points.

I was disappointed when this FAQ came out, but them’s the rules
